  • Overview The nine miles of hiking trails at Robert H. Treman State Park wander into gorges and lead to beautiful waterfalls. Fishing, hunting and swimming are popular at the park.   • Overview The gorge at Watkins Glen is the best-known in the Finger Lakes region. The one-and-one-half-mile-long trough was scoured by glaciers, creating 19 waterfalls and 300-foot shale and sandstone cliffs.
